Transaction 77d03a32761376808c81beb539229185cd47e60f3ca9b3bd555a744fb899ef7c
1 Input
1 Output
-
77d03a32761376808c81beb539229185cd47e60f3ca9b3bd555a744fb899ef7c:0
- value
- 108787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d18799345bd724ea383822fa1d3abdd06ee25501 OP_EQUAL
- address
- 3LnubBWzyXGG97BuFacMK9BgM2sPSs33Wm